Designing a platform approach to support ad-hoc data science workloads while protecting production stability and costs.
A practical guide explores building a platform that enables flexible, exploratory data science work without destabilizing production systems or inflating operational expenses, focusing on governance, scalability, and disciplined experimentation.
July 18, 2025
Facebook X Reddit
In modern organizations, data science teams demand rapid access to computing resources, diverse environments, and flexible data access. Yet production pipelines require predictable latency, robust monitoring, and strict cost controls. The tension between experimentation and stability often results in delayed projects or unexpected outages. A platform-led approach seeks to harmonize these needs by providing self-service capabilities under governance. This means offering clearly defined environments for development, testing, and production, while enforcing billing boundaries, access controls, and policy-driven automation. By designing for both speed and safeguards, teams can pursue innovative analyses without compromising reliability, reproducibility, or cost efficiency across the enterprise.
A well-architected platform starts with a shared data layer that emphasizes provenance, lineage, and quality checks. Centralized data catalogs, metadata management, and consistent data contracts help ensure that ad-hoc workloads operate on trusted sources. On the compute side, a mix of scalable resource pools and containerized runtimes enables run-anywhere experimentation while isolating workloads to prevent spillover. Role-based access and policy enforcement govern who can access what data and which compute resources they may deploy. Importantly, cost awareness should be baked in from the outset, with usage dashboards, chargeback models, and automated shutdowns to curb runaway spending.
Creating safe, scalable, and accountable ad-hoc workloads.
To realize this balance, teams implement a tiered environment strategy, where experimentation occurs in a sandbox that mirrors production data permissions but isolates risk. Each workspace includes predefined tooling, templates, and governance checks that guide analysts through reproducible workflows. When a project matures, a formal handoff converts experiments into validated components that can be audited and extended by others. This progression minimizes surprises when shifting from exploration to deployment. By codifying practices—such as versioned notebooks, automated testing, and data quality checks—the platform preserves integrity without stifling curiosity.
ADVERTISEMENT
ADVERTISEMENT
Equally critical is the notion of spend visibility at the granularity of individual projects. Cost-aware scheduling, spot instances, and dynamic resource tagging help teams see where resources are consumed and why. A self-service catalog with pre-approved compute profiles reduces decision fatigue while ensuring compliance with security and governance rules. Operational dashboards should correlate compute usage with business impact, enabling leaders to rebalance priorities if costs begin to drift. With clear incentives and transparent reporting, data scientists can pursue ambitious analyses while the organization maintains financial discipline and predictability.
Integrating ad-hoc work within a stable production backbone.
Beyond tooling, the human element drives platform success. Training and enablement programs teach practitioners how to design experiments responsibly, document findings, and reuse artifacts. Communities of practice foster knowledge sharing, reducing duplicated effort and accelerating learning curves. When analysts understand governance expectations and available patterns, they can craft experiments that align with strategic objectives. Mentors and champions help diffuse best practices, ensuring that new team members quickly adopt consistent methodologies. In turn, this cultural shift enhances collaboration, reduces risk, and accelerates the pace of discovery without sacrificing stability.
ADVERTISEMENT
ADVERTISEMENT
Automation underpins repeatability. Infrastructure as code, continuous integration pipelines, and policy-as-code expressions enforce reproducible environments and governance checks without manual intervention. Semantic versioning for data pipelines, coupled with automated rollback mechanisms, provides resilience against unexpected results. As teams scale, centralized telemetry and anomaly detection guard against subtle configuration drifts that could escalate into production incidents. By investing in automation that embodies both agility and reliability, the platform becomes a force multiplier for data science efficiency.
Designing cost-effective, resilient data science environments.
A durable production backbone requires strict separation of concerns. Production workloads should be shielded from unstable exploratory tasks, yet accessible in curated ways for collaboration and validation. Data products released from experiments follow controlled promotion paths, with checks for schema evolution, data quality, and backward compatibility. Observability across both experimentation and production helps pinpoint issues quickly, reducing the blast radius of failures. Clear SLAs, incident response playbooks, and runbooks ensure that operators can respond rapidly to changing conditions, preserving service levels while supporting ongoing experimentation.
The platform should support scalable data movement and governance, enabling secure data sharing across teams. Fine-grained access controls, token-based authentication, and encrypted storage protect sensitive information while allowing legitimate researchers to work efficiently. Data stewardship practices assign responsibility for data quality, lineage, and policy compliance, ensuring accountability at every stage. When combined with automated data masking and synthetic data generation, teams can safely explore insights without exposing confidential details. The outcome is a resilient ecosystem where innovation thrives within a solid, audited framework.
ADVERTISEMENT
ADVERTISEMENT
Practical considerations for long-term platform health.
Choosing the right mix of compute options is central to cost efficiency. On-demand resources paired with autoscaling and smart queuing prevent idle capacity while preserving performance. Spot pricing can lower expenses for non-critical tasks, provided recovery strategies exist for interruptions. Cataloging approved templates and workloads ensures consistency and reduces waste from ad-hoc configurations. Cost governance should be visible directly in the analytics workspace, empowering analysts to make informed trade-offs between speed, accuracy, and expense. A disciplined approach to resource planning protects the bottom line without restricting creative experimentation.
Resilience emerges from layered safeguards. Circuit breakers, automated retries, and graceful degradation help experiments survive transient failures. Data quality gates, anomaly detectors, and rigorous validation steps catch issues early, preventing corrupted results from propagating into production. By adopting a fault-tolerant design mindset, teams can push boundaries while maintaining user trust and system stability. Documentation that captures decisions, assumptions, and limitations further shields the organization from surprises, ensuring that future work builds on a solid foundation.
Governance cannot be an afterthought; it must be embedded in every workflow. Establishing clear ownership, policy hierarchies, and escalation paths helps maintain order as teams grow. Regular audits of data access, usage patterns, and cost profiles reveal opportunities for optimization and risk reduction. A forward-looking roadmap should anticipate emerging tools, evolving security requirements, and changing regulatory landscapes, ensuring the platform remains relevant and robust. Strategic partnerships with vendors and open-source communities enrich capabilities while enabling cost-sharing and innovation. With thoughtful governance and continuous improvement, the platform sustains productive ad-hoc work for years to come.
In the end, the platform serves as a stable launchpad for exploration. It empowers data scientists to test hypotheses, iterate rapidly, and derive actionable insights without destabilizing environments or ballooning budgets. By balancing autonomy with control, the organization gains a competitive edge through faster decision cycles and higher-quality outcomes. The most successful designs are those that treat experimentation as a core capability, integrated into the fabric of daily work, and supported by a resilient, scalable, and cost-conscious infrastructure. Such a platform not only accelerates results but also builds lasting trust between technical teams and the business.
Related Articles
Effective incremental data repair relies on targeted recomputation, not wholesale rebuilds, to reduce downtime, conserve resources, and preserve data quality across evolving datasets and schemas.
July 16, 2025
This evergreen guide examines practical strategies for delivering SQL-first data access alongside robust programmatic APIs, enabling engineers and analysts to query, integrate, and build scalable data solutions with confidence.
July 31, 2025
This evergreen guide explores consistent methods to quantify data processing emissions, evaluates lifecycle impacts of pipelines, and outlines practical strategies for reducing energy use while preserving performance and reliability.
July 21, 2025
This evergreen guide explores resilient backfill architectures, practical strategies, and governance considerations for recomputing historical metrics when definitions, transformations, or data sources shift, ensuring consistency and trustworthy analytics over time.
July 19, 2025
This evergreen guide explains practical practices for setting error budgets across data service layers, balancing innovation with reliability, and outlining processes to allocate resources where they most enhance system trust.
July 26, 2025
Semantic search and recommendations demand scalable vector similarity systems; this article explores practical optimization strategies, from indexing and quantization to hybrid retrieval, caching, and operational best practices for robust performance.
August 11, 2025
A practical, evergreen guide on building partner data feeds that balance privacy, efficiency, and usefulness through systematic curation, thoughtful governance, and scalable engineering practices.
July 30, 2025
A structured onboarding checklist empowers data teams to accelerate data source integration, ensure data quality, and mitigate post-launch challenges by aligning stakeholders, standards, and governance from day one.
August 04, 2025
Efficient partition compaction and disciplined file management unlock faster queries on object-storage datasets, balancing update costs, storage efficiency, and scalability through adaptive layouts, metadata strategies, and proactive maintenance.
July 26, 2025
A practical, end-to-end guide to crafting synthetic datasets that preserve critical edge scenarios, rare distributions, and real-world dependencies, enabling robust model training, evaluation, and validation across domains.
July 15, 2025
This article examines durable, scalable approaches for honoring data deletion requests across distributed storage, ensuring compliance while preserving system integrity, availability, and auditability in modern data architectures.
July 18, 2025
This evergreen guide dives into resilient strategies for designing, versioning, and sharing feature engineering pipelines that power both research experiments and production-grade models, ensuring consistency, traceability, and scalable deployment across teams and environments.
July 28, 2025
Semantic enrichment pipelines convert raw event streams into richly annotated narratives by layering contextual metadata, enabling faster investigations, improved anomaly detection, and resilient streaming architectures across diverse data sources and time windows.
August 12, 2025
This evergreen guide explains how sandboxed analytics environments powered by synthetic clones can dramatically lower risk, accelerate experimentation, and preserve data integrity, privacy, and compliance across complex data pipelines and diverse stakeholders.
July 16, 2025
Effective deduplication hinges on resilient keys that tolerate data variability, integrate multiple signals, and adapt to shared and divergent formats without sacrificing accuracy or performance across diverse data ecosystems.
August 12, 2025
A practical guide reveals robust strategies to store, index, and query high-cardinality categorical features without sacrificing performance, accuracy, or scalability, drawing on proven engineering patterns and modern tooling.
August 08, 2025
This article explores resilient patterns that separate data schema evolution from consumer deployment cycles, enabling independent releases, reducing coupling risk, and maintaining smooth analytics continuity across evolving data ecosystems.
August 04, 2025
This evergreen guide explores systematic strategies to model, detect, and resolve transformation dependencies, ensuring robust data pipelines, scalable graphs, and reliable analytics without circular reference pitfalls.
July 18, 2025
This evergreen guide explores practical design patterns for integrating online transactional processing and analytical workloads, leveraging storage systems and query engines purpose-built to optimize performance, consistency, and scalability in modern data architectures.
August 06, 2025
Observational data often misleads decisions unless causal inference pipelines are methodically designed and rigorously validated, ensuring robust conclusions, transparent assumptions, and practical decision-support in dynamic environments.
July 26, 2025